Synopsis

Spacecraft TT and Information Transmission Theory and Technologies introduces the basic theory of spacecraft TT (telemetry, track and command) and information transmission. Combining TT and information transmission, the book presents several technologies for continuous wave radar including measurements for range, range rate and angle, analog and digital information transmissions, telecommand, telemetry, remote sensing and spread spectrum TT For special problems occurred in the channels for TT and information transmission, the book represents radio propagation features and its impact on orbit measurement accuracy, and the effects caused by rain attenuation, atmospheric attenuation and multi-path effect, and polarization composition technology. This book can benefit researchers and engineers in the field of spacecraft TT and communication systems.
